With this discount, the AirPods Pro 2 have now reached the lowest price point they've ever seen following their release in September. Woot's sale has been automatically applied so you don't need any coupon code or have to wait until checkout to see the discount.



The AirPods Pro 2 are similar in design to the original AirPods Pro, featuring a rounded design with silicone ear tips and a short stem. Apple added the H2 chip that enables new capabilities, including improved Active Noise Cancellation and and update to Transparency mode with an Adaptive Transparency feature that is designed to reduce loud environmental noise without blocking out all sound.

"A tonne of discarded mobile phones is richer in gold than a tonne of gold ore," Dr. Ruediger Kuehr, director of the UN's Sustainable Cycles (SCYCLE) Programme, said in a statement. "Embedded in 1 million cell phones, for example, are 24 kg of gold, 16,000 kg of copper, 350 kg of silver, and 14 kg of palladium — resources that could be recovered and returned to the production cycle. And if we fail to recycle these materials, new supplies need to be mined, harming the environment."
